About Haven Middle School
Haven Middle School is a regular public middle school located in Evanston, Illinois. Serving students from sixth to eighth grade, the school has an enrollment of 686 students and maintains a student-teacher ratio of 10.7:1, ensuring that each student receives personalized attention. With 64 full-time equivalent teachers, Haven Middle School aims to provide a supportive learning environment.
Academically, Haven Middle School holds a MySchoolScout rating of 6.9 out of 10 and ranks at #770 among the 3819 schools in Illinois, placing it in the 80th percentile statewide. In ELA/reading proficiency, 34% of students are rated proficient or above, while in math, 43% meet or exceed proficiency standards. These scores indicate that there is room for academic growth and improvement.
Haven Middle School is situated in a small city setting within Cook County, offering its students access to local amenities and resources. The school community fosters an environment where students can grow and develop both academically and socially.

Performance Trends
Math proficiency has declined from 51% (2019) to 35% (2021). Reading/ELA proficiency has declined from 46% (2019) to 30% (2022).

Community Profile
The community surrounding Haven Middle School has a median household income of $92,101. It is a well-educated community where 74%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$577,800, with a median rent of $1,792/month. The area has a poverty rate of 14.2%. The average commute for residents is 27 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
